## Executive Snapshot
**What it is:** 1Password is a cross-platform password manager and credential governance tool for individuals and enterprise teams.
**Why users hire it:** Users hire 1Password to centralize sensitive data and secure agentic workflows, but the subscription-only model creates friction for legacy users who prioritize data ownership.

## Rivals Landscape {#rivals}

> Competitive positioning identified by AI analysis of app features, category, and market signals.

### 1Password 7 - Password Manager vs Dashlane Password Manager — Head to Head
- **[Dashlane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/com-dashlane-dashlanephonefinal)** by Dashlane: With 16 releases in the last six months and a massive user base, Dashlane represents the most aggressive, high-velocity competitor in the password management space.
  - **Moat strength:** High — sustainable advantage over 12 months
  - **Key differences:**
    - Maintains a high-frequency release cadence of 16 updates per six months to ensure rapid feature deployment.
    - Aggressively integrates cross-platform password health monitoring tools that go beyond simple credential storage.
    - Positions itself as a comprehensive identity protection suite rather than a standalone password vault.
  - **Where 1Password 7 - Password Manager wins:**
    - ✅ Offers a more focused, lightweight user experience for users who prioritize simplicity over complex identity suites.
    - ✅ Maintains a legacy of trust and brand recognition among long-term power users of the 1Password ecosystem.
  - **Where Dashlane Password Manager wins:**
    - ❌ Provides a more robust, feature-rich dashboard that includes integrated VPN and dark web monitoring services.
    - ❌ Maintains a superior release velocity that allows for faster adaptation to new OS-level security protocols.
  - **Verdict:** The target app must decide whether to remain a specialized vault or expand into identity protection to prevent further churn to Dashlane's comprehensive suite.

### Contenders (Strong Challengers)
- **[Bitwarden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/bitwarden-password-manager)** by Bitwarden Inc [Moat: Medium]: Bitwarden's open-source model and high-velocity development cycle make it a primary threat to market share.
  - Leverages an open-source architecture that builds significant trust and transparency with security-conscious technical users.
  - Offers a highly competitive free tier that provides full vault functionality without the restrictive paywalls of competitors.
- **[Keeper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/d4d2433bgc)** by Callpod Inc. [Moat: Medium]: Keeper maintains a massive user base and high ratings, serving as a direct alternative for enterprise-focused password management.
  - Focuses heavily on enterprise-grade security compliance and administrative controls for team-based credential management.
  - Provides a highly polished, consistent cross-platform experience that minimizes friction for non-technical enterprise users.
- **[RoboForm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/roboform-password-manager)** by Siber Systems, Inc. [Moat: Low]: A long-standing player in the space that continues to iterate with consistent updates and a loyal user base.
  - Specializes in advanced form-filling capabilities that outperform standard browser-based auto-fill solutions.
  - Maintains a legacy-focused feature set that caters to users requiring complex, multi-step web form automation.

### Peers (What They Do Better)
- **[LastPass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/com-lastpass-ilastpass)** by LastPass US LP: Despite sentiment challenges, its massive scale and brand presence keep it as a relevant peer in the category.
  - Maintains deep integration with legacy browser ecosystems that many enterprise users are still heavily reliant upon.
  - Offers a broad, recognizable feature set that serves as the baseline expectation for the password management category.
- **[Enpass Password Manager](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/productivity/enpass-password-manager)** by Enpass Technologies Private Limited: A niche alternative that focuses on local-first storage, appealing to users wary of cloud-only synchronization.
  - Allows users to store vault data on their own cloud storage providers rather than a proprietary server.
  - Targets privacy-conscious users who prefer a non-subscription, local-first data ownership model.
- **[Sticky Password Manager & Safe](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/utilities/sticky-password-manager-safe)** by Lamantine Software a.s.: A utility-focused competitor that emphasizes ease of use and traditional password management workflows.
  - Provides a simplified, utility-first interface that avoids the complexity of modern identity protection suites.
  - Offers a lifetime license option which serves as a direct counter-position to the industry-standard subscription model.
